Základne pojmy použité v programe OpenOffice.org Base

Databáza v programe Base obsahuje polia, ktoré obsahujú jednotlivé dáta. Každá tabuľka databázy je zoskupením polí. Pri vytváraní tabuľky tiež určíme charakteristiku každého poľa tabuľky. Formuláre sú určené pre vkladanie dát do polí. S jedným formulárom je spojená jedna alebo viac tabuliek. Formuláre môžu byť tiež použité na prezeranie polí jednej alebo viacerých tabuliek prepojených s formulárom. Dotaz vytvára novú tabuľku z existujúcich tabuliek, na základe toho ako vytvoríte dotaz. Zostava (správa) zoraďuje informácie z polí dotazu do dokumentu v zhode s našimi požiadavkami.

Program Base z kancelárskeho balíka OpenOffice.org pracuje s relačnými databázami (existujú i iné typy databáz). Takýto typ databáz umožňuje, aby malo jedno pole (viď nižšie) vzťah s ďalšími poľami.

Napríklad si predstavte databázu pre knižnicu. Takáto databáza obsahuje pole s menami autorov a iné pole s menom kníh. Medzi týmito poľami je očividný vzťah - autori a knihy, ktoré napísali. Knižnica môže obsahovať viac ako jednu knihu od toho istého autora. Takýto vzťah je známy ako 1:N jeden autor a viac ako jedna kniha. Väčšina, ak nie všetky vzťahy v databáze (v programe Base), je takéhoto typu.

Predstavte si databázu zamestnancov v rovnakej knižnici. Jedno pole obsahuje mená zamestnancov zatiaľ čo ďalšie obsahujú rodné číslo a iné osobné dáta. Vzťah medzi menami a rodnými číslami je 1:1 - každému menu prislúcha práve jedno rodné číslo.

Ak poznáte matematické množiny, relačné databázy môžeme jednoducho vysvetliť pomocou termínov množín: prvky, podmnožiny, zjednotenie, a prienik. Polia databázy sú prvky. Tabuľky sú podmnožiny. Vzťahy sú definované ako zjednotenia a prieniky podmnožín (tabuliek).

Takže ešte raz vysvetlenie jednotlivých pojmov, ktoré sa používajú v programe Base.

Databáza – množstvo údajov (dát), ktoré sú organizované v tabuľkách. Môže ju tvoriť viac tabuliek, ktoré navzájom súvisia.

Tabuľka - zoskupenie údajov s definovaným typom do stĺpcov s hlavičkou.

Relácia – trvalé spojenie tabuliek v databáze. Relácia sa používa na riadenie dátových väzieb medzi tabuľkami.

Formulár – umožňuje užívateľsky príjemnejší pohľad na databázu. Je možné zobraziť, vkladať a upravovať viac údajov z jedného záznamu alebo údaje zo záznamov prepojených tabuliek .

Dotaz – výber a zaradenie údajov podľa pravidiel, ktoré zadefinuje používateľ. Je ho možné použiť k spojovaniu údajov rôznych tabuliek a ďalších dotazov.

Záznam - jeden riadok tabuľky.

Pole - stĺpec tabuľky - súhrn rovnakých údajov v stĺpcoch

Dátový typ – určuje druh údajov, ktoré sú v danom poli uložené.

Správa / Zostava – spôsob prezentácie údajov pre výstupné zariadenie (monitor, tlačiareň).

Indexy - polia, podľa ktorých sa usporiadavajú záznamy. Nemusia byt definované, ale môžu.

Primárny kľúč – index, ktorý musí obsahovať každá tabuľka. Nedovoľuje uložiť duplicitný záznam do tabuľky a usporiadava záznamy do tabuľky.